If you’re a hardcore fan of theMass Effectseries, then you might find an unexpected bit of joy inDragon Age: The Veilguard.

Developers BioWare has added two new outfits to the game as part of the latest update (both available for Rook), and it’s heavily inspired by the N7 design. Such is the resemblance that any lover of EA’s sci-fi series will be immediately able to relate to the new armor. Moreover, this outfit is available for all, and it can be found directly inside the game.

How to obtain the Mass Effect armor in Dragon Age: The Veilguard

Obtaining the new outfit is pretty straightforward, but you will have to clear a fair bit of the main campaign. In fact, the quest for “The Singing Blade” must be completed, as it takes Rook to Scout Harding to search for the Lyrium Knife. First, find the missing knife dropped by Solas, and you’ll be able to gain access to the Lighthouse and Caretaker’s Workshop.

Once you’ve added these items to your inventory, you’ll be able to change into them from your wardrobe. I love the fact that the designs aren’t a direct copy of how they appeared inMass Effectgames. BioWare has kept the vintage threads and the color code alive, but the design has been modified to fit well into the lore ofDragon Age: The Veilguard.

As of this writing, there doesn’t appear to be an expiration date for these rewards. However, there’s no point in dilly-dallying, and you should redeem the outfits as early as possible.
